Output 9332436087de541c5e4140e6291539155b942f524ba95893053c6f674b908fe8:0

value
19000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9db90a385e23478e12cfb526132ab1d86b6b6ba5 OP_EQUAL
address
3G4ygTert2vXNZDZYNJ8C1kU6rWNDGbdEU
transaction
9332436087de541c5e4140e6291539155b942f524ba95893053c6f674b908fe8
confirmations
510122
spent
true